- Abstract:
- Abstract : Objectives: To discuss methodological issues related to using salivary biomarkers to evaluate response to a stress management intervention. Method: Findings from a study which utilised salivary biomarkers to evaluate group responses to a stress management program are discussed. In that study, we measured responses to qigong practice as a stress intervention among 34 healthy adults. Results: Specific biomarkers studied were a stress hormone (cortisol); a surrogate marker co-released with acute stress (alpha amylase); and a marker of early physiological response to stress i.e. immune status as reflected by immunoglobulin A (IgA). Salivary cortisol and IgA were monitored over 10 weeks in the intervention group (n = 18) and the control group (n = 16). Median salivary cortisol concentrations (nmol/l) at weeks 1, 6 and 10 were 4.4, 4.8, 4.3 and 4.3, 4.0, 3.3 for the control and intervention groups. Median IgA secretion rates (μg/min) were 58.9, 63.6 and 67.4 for the control group and 43.8, 54.9 and 72.9 for the intervention group. Acute response to qigong practice, measured by median salivary alpha amylase (U/ml) showed no significant change before and after a one hour session of practice (107.7 and 93.8). Saliva collection technique, circadian rhythm and half-life of the biomarkers, and their relative concentrations in different body compartments e.g. blood and saliva, can affect the results and were taken into account in the study protocol.
